Our collaborative culture and our innovative, sustainable approach to projects help us create buildings that matter to our world.Together, we are enhancing the quality of life globally through design.Join us and design your place with Stantec.Your OpportunityAs a Principal, Healthcare Mechanical Engineering, one must bring deep knowledge and thought leadership that is client-facing. A focus on experience and relationships in the A/E industry to contribute to the overall strategic and tactical leadership of the Stantec Health Sector engineering discipline, building and leading the health sector engineering practice in the Los Angeles area. This position is client-facing requiring leadership in strategic projects, while advancing the overall engineering practice as well as team growth and development. In addition, business development, contributions to project delivery standards and work processes, quality control, workload forecasting, financial performance accountability and collaboration with other disciplines is critical. The Principal contributes to differentiating Stantec from other competing firms and thereby positions Stantec as innovators in the industry.Your Key ResponsibilitiesBusiness Development/Marketing – approximately 25% of timeBe a primary contributor to building Stantec’s Health Sector Engineering practice in the Los Angeles area.Interface regularly with additional architectural, mechanical engineering and electrical engineering leaders in US West and across North America to thrive and contribute within the integrated design practiceDevelop and execute strategic and tactical business and marketing plans for the health sector engineering practice in California that align with Business Center, regional Buildings team, and Global Health Sector goals to advance the overall practice.Sustain and grow top line revenue helping to achieve growth objectives in the Los Angeles and US West areas in collaboration with the Regional Business Leader, Business Center Practice Leaders, and Engineering leaders in US West to achieve key operational performance metrics.Develop and maintain industry relationships and visibility with current and prospective clients, sub-consultants, and partner firms in the local and regional A/E industry.Assist with the development of the annual business plan and budget for the business center and working with the leadership team to achieve key performance indicators.Develop presentation materials and present to clients at strategic industry events.Represent the firm through published articles, public speaking engagements and attendance at industry and community events, meetings, and conferences.Develop project proposals.Assist the marketing department with the development of health sector, engineering, marketing materials and content.People and Practice Management – approximately 15% of timeHire and lead a team consisting of engineering project managers, designers, and CAD/Revit production team members.In conjunction with other stakeholders, identify and forecast staff needs and assignments based on current and projected workload and SME requirements.Hold project team members accountable for technical excellence, delivery standards, and best practices.Responsible for managing financial performance, quality control processes, and project delivery for Mechanical Engineering projects.Ensure compliance with best practices, including Stantec PM Frameworks Project Involvement.Project Design and Delivery – approximately 50% of timeWork with PM's and SMEs on key projects to develop and deliver client drawings, specifications, presentations, reports, and other deliverables.Successfully manage projects of significant scope, complexity, and revenue budget.Apply buildings engineering and project management knowledge while leading cross-functional resources to meet project requirements within established timeframes and budgets.Meet technical, contractual, schedule, budgetary and client service objectives for projects.Apply strong engineering skills, experience and knowledge to the design and oversight of the design for building projects.Manage and plan the production resources and workflow to produce the design documentation, drawings, and calculations required for engineering projects.Act as a QC reviewer on Health Sector Engineering projects.Technical Leadership – approximately 10% of timeMaintain awareness of operational, technical, or regulatory changes within Mechanical Engineering and AEC industry overall, disseminate such knowledge to team and firm, and integrate into existing processes and standards.Assist to maintain and update Health Sector Engineering specifications, technical documentation, and standards in collaboration with other technical resources within Stantec.Oversee Healthcare Engineering Design delivery process and best practices and coordinate with other disciplines.Provide oversight for Healthcare Engineering staff education and certification process & balance firm, studio and staff need.Learning/Maintaining and Expanding Technical and Managerial Skills.Maintain current knowledge of technologies and trends impacting Stantec's core service offerings and markets and continually strengthens skills.Your Capabilities and CredentialsOutstanding client service skills with ability to lead practice members in consistently delivering an exceptional standard of service to every client.Strong managerial skills with ability to hire, engage, develop, and retain top-tier talent.Strong business acumen with ability to identify, develop and map strategy, prepare, interpret, and manage budgets, and analyze business results.Business development skills with ability to identify and develop prospects, nurture key relationships, cross-sell services, negotiate, and engage business.Comprehensive understanding of building project components, project management and delivery systems; ability to continuously evaluate and refine processes to increase efficiency and client satisfaction.Ability to manage clients, projects, fees, scope, and teams to achieve budget, schedule and deliverable objectives while meeting key stakeholder critical success factors.Familiarity with, and ability to produce, project-related documents and documentation standards required of a Project Manager.Ability to integrate design elements with other disciplines to deliver a coordinated design.Strong knowledge of applicable codes and standards.A commanding knowledge of technical issues supporting delivered design services.Deep technical understanding and working knowledge of buildings systems.Strong knowledge of the Health Sector market externally,Deep understanding of and ability to apply sustainable design principles within projects.Outstanding consulting skills with ability to present a credible, engaging image in keeping with Stantec’s high service standards.Excellent verbal and written communication skills and polished presentation and public speaking skills.Fundamental understanding of NFPA 99, ASHRAE 170, and the California Building and Energy codes as they specifically apply to hospitals, ambulatory surgical centers, and medical office buildings.Deep knowledge of healthcare plumbing, fuel oil systems and medical gas systems.Experience in identifying and managing items of risk that may occur on projects.Ability to identify and manage potential unanticipated scope.Passion to integrate design elements with other disciplines to deliver a coordinated design.Dedication to apply sustainable design principles within projects while maintaining the process driven requirements of healthcare facilities.Successful history of collaboration with contractors in various construction delivery processes such as Design assistance, Design-Build, and IPD.Possess a valid driver's license with a good driving record.Education and ExperienceBachelors' degree in Engineering plus 15+ years related professional experience required.Professional Engineering license required.Project Management Professional certification a plus.LEED AP Credential preferred.Possess a valid driver’s license with good driving record.Obtained ASHRAE Healthcare Facility Design Professional (HFDP) certification or similar specific to engineering discipline.Typical office environment working with computers and remaining sedentary for long periods of time.
